Η τεχνολογία HDR εξομοιώνει τον φυσικό φωτισμό. "HDRI is a very versatile technology. The vast amount of infomation about the range of light content of a scene makes it possible to simulate true lighting of a reproduction of the scene if one had a device that could fully reproduce the captured light intensity." http://www.lgproductions.com/HDRI/HDRIintro.html Οι φανατικοί των παιχνιδιών ξέρουν καλύτερα :) "High-Dynamic Range Lighting is basically the last piece of chasing really good lighting in a digital world. What we’re doing here is completing the promise when we said back in the old days, “We’re going to have real-time lighting.” What that really came down to was, well, your shadow was real and maybe some weapons effects. But for all intents and purposes, each level is basically phony lighting—it’s all full-bright because of the gameplay path, and the hardware wasn’t able to do true lighting. So if you look at an image or any area of Half Life 2, you notice that the sky is usually kind of bright, and the ground is kind of bright—that’s there for gameplay and technology reasons." http://www.rage3d.com/board/showthread.php?t=33810372&page=3 -------------------------------------------------- Note added at 56 mins (2007-04-18 16:55:58 GMT) -------------------------------------------------- Και σύμφωνα με τα κιτάπια του Κωνσταντίνου, το true μπορεί να αποδοθεί και ως "πραγματικός".
